# K07 — `TaskHandle_t`, explicit `start()` and static trampoline K07 isolates the exact C/C++ task-entry boundary. A local `CounterTask` object is constructed without touching the FreeRTOS heap. Only an explicit `start()` calls `xTaskCreate()` and passes the stable object address as `void*` context. The kernel later calls a static, non-virtual trampoline, which recovers the typed object and invokes its private `run()` member. ```text CounterTask object -> start() -> xTaskCreate(static trampoline, context=&object) -> kernel chooses task -> trampoline(void*) -> static_cast(context) -> object.run() -> state=completed, handle=nullptr, vTaskDelete(nullptr) ``` The wrapper is non-copyable and non-movable because a live kernel task retains its object address. The destructor does not attempt asynchronous task deletion. ## Three distinct address domains The checked Hazard3 run records: ```text C++ object = 0x800fffcc (local object on the retained main stack) TCB/handle = 0x800038b0 (dynamic kernel object in ucHeap) task stack = 0x800034a0..0x80003890 result = 500500 ``` The object address remains identical before start, in `xTaskCreate` context, inside the trampoline, inside `run()` and at completion.
